How do living systems control the movement of materials into and out of cells?

Biology
1 answer:
Sholpan [36]3 years ago
3 0

Answer:

by a process called diffusion osmosis and active transport.

Explanation:

diffusion : movement of particles from a higher concentration to a lower concentration down to ge concentration gradient

osmosis: movement of water from higher water potential to a lower water potential through a partially permiable memberane

active transport: movement of ions from a lower concentration to a higher concentration against concentration gradient using energy from respiration
